Conductor – Prof. Raffaele Cipriano

Our Classical Orchestra is an advanced full orchestra in our Senior School. The Classical Orchestra performs standard orchestral repertoire from the Classical period onwards, as well as 18th & 19th Century Opera.

In addition to its standard performance calendar, Classical Orchestra has performed at the Martin Luther King, Jr. State Celebration Commission’s annual concert, for the Kansas City Chinese-American Association Chinese New Year Celebration, and other special performance opportunities including exchange concerts with other regional youth orchestra programs. Recent performances at the Kansas City Classic Festival of Beethoven’s 5th Symphony and excerpts from Bizet’s “Carmen” at the Kaufman Center brought several standing ovations.

 

 

Musicians accepted into Symphony and Classical Orchestra are eligible to also participate in YSKC’s Touring Orchestra.

Historical Touring Orchestra highlights include performances across Ireland in 2016 and in 2018 in Austria as a part of Youth Symphony of Kansas City’s 60th Anniversary Season. In 2023, the Orchestra performed Respighi’s “Pines of Rome” and Stolzel’s “City Beautiful” at Carnegie Hall in New York.

Meet Raffaele Cipriano

Raffaele Cipriano is an esteemed Italian conductor, opera coach, and composer, excited to work with the Youth Symphony of Kansas City and guide young musicians in learning masterpieces of symphonic literature.

Trained at the prestigious Conservatories of Padua and Venice, he excels in orchestral conducting, collaborative piano, opera repertoire, and composition.

About YSKC

YSKC was founded as The Youth Symphony of the Heart of America by Leo Scheer consisting of an orchestra of 80 musicians, 22 and younger. Incorporated in 1958, YSKC has enjoyed a vibrant history as the musical home to students in Kansas City. Today, the Youth Symphony of Kansas City serves more than 400 musicians in grades 5-12 and is comprised of four full orchestras, a preparatory strings ensemble, multiple ancillary programs, the Opus 76 Quartet Residency, and our new YSKC Academy program. Throughout its 65 years of programming, YSKC has built an alumni class of more than 10,000, completed international tours to Austria, Canada, Germany, Ireland, Italy, and Spain, and performed at numerous prestigious festivals and conferences nationwide.
